Jakey’s Amish Barbeque, Lancaster, Pennsylvania

Jakey’s was just a random restaurant my aunt and I stumbled into while we were hungry in Lancaster. I had the Steak BBQ and my aunt had the Boc Boi. Boc Boi. LOL.

This was the BBQ Steak. What I like about it the most is the bread. Oh my god. The bread was just a little crispy on the outside and soooo soft on the inside. It still had flour on the outer part, which I love. Because it gives the recently-baked feeling. Mmm. The sliced meat was so tender and the sauce was delicious! I think the liquid-y brown-y was just a normal barbecue sauce. But the combination of everything was nice.
